Web Application For Weather Forecast
Mucha, Kamil ; Burget, Radek (referee) ; Bartík, Vladimír (advisor)
The aim of this bachelor thesis is to design and implement a web application for weather forecast. This will require collecting the data about weather forecast from public data sources, so it is crucial to choose the appropriate data source. These data will be stored in the database and will be updated on a regular basis. Based on the current weather, the app will also create weather history. On the web page, these data will be displayed in the form of a graph where user can select the location and choose the exact time from which the data will be displayed. If there is no data stored in the database for that location, it is redirected to the nearest location with available data.
Weather Forecast Mashup
Gajdušek, Radek ; Svoboda, Pavel (referee) ; Kajan, Rudolf (advisor)
The goal of bachelor's thesis "Weather forecast - mashup" is the design and implementation of application, which gathers data from multiple sources in XML format using Silverlight technology. In addition to the description of the individual stages of application development the thesis also contains the clarifying of the term mashup, analyses Web 2.0 and defines the basic terms of weather forecast. Attention is paid to Silverlight and its comparison with the main competitor in the market. The thesis also includes the evaluation of the achieved results, together with thinking about the future possible application development.

Weather Forecast Based on Different Sources
Hořák, Martin ; Kořenek, Jan (referee) ; Novotný, Tomáš (advisor)
Bachelor thesis deals with the weather forecast through the artificial neural network with backpropagation method. The forecast is based on data obtained from freely accessible services offering weather information. The created application downloads and saves the forecasts from servers and creates a new forecast. The results of the prediction are being compared with the reality and the original services.

Simple FITkit Based Weather-Station
Podivínský, Jakub ; Mičulka, Lukáš (referee) ; Strnadel, Josef (advisor)
In this bachelor thesis, the design and implementation of FITkit-based home weather-station is presented. In the thesis, various methods of measuring meteorological quantities are detailed and discussed together with advanteges and disadvantages of common electronic sensor parameters. Then, weather forecast methods are classified and principle of a simple weather-forecast algorithm based on the atmospheric pressure measurement and analysis is described and discussed according to its realization by the means of the FITkit platform. At the end of the thesis, design and realization of an additional hardware needed to operate the station on basis of FITkit is described.
Precipitation Forecast from Weather Radar
Tábi, Matej ; Milička, Martin (referee) ; Burget, Radek (advisor)
The aim of this bachelor thesis is a web application, which solves a short-time precipitation forecast for Czech Republic. The forecast is created for the next one hour and consists of four radar frames with a 15 minutes distance between them.  The task is solved in three main steps. In the first step, the actual information from CHMI webpages is obtained. In the second step, the recieved data is processed - precipitation fields are identified and in the last step, movement vectors of these precipitation fields are calculated.  The result of the thesis is a fully working web application. The forecast success rate is at the level from 30 to 60%.
Short-Term Forecast Based on Image of Sky
Volf, Martin ; Španěl, Michal (referee) ; Hradiš, Michal (advisor)
The bachelor's thesis submitted is dedicated to weather forecast based only on a video stream. At first, basic weather information which the sky can provide are presented. Cloud types including their properties and methods which the sky can most efficiently describe are dealt with. At second, basic circumstances between weather information are discussed. The objective of this work is to prove accuracy of the methods used for gaining data from the video stream and to find out whether it could be possible to use them for forecasting the rain, air humidity and sunshine for the period of time one hour later.
